Transaction 8560d8d317dedba43580053cedc47419ba799f9c06d85291eae40627a40337c4
1 Input
1 Output
-
8560d8d317dedba43580053cedc47419ba799f9c06d85291eae40627a40337c4:0
- value
- 483890
- script pubkey
- OP_0 OP_PUSHBYTES_20 81450c4eb176bf72c2ca60001bf139c775c29e65
- address
- bc1qs9zscn43w6lh9sk2vqqphufeca6u98n9pzlsfa